About us Founded in 1963, Webber is a leading construction company that specializes in heavy civil, waterworks, energy and infrastructure management and is dedicated to safely providing intelligent solutions to its clients and community. Webber is headquartered in Houston, Texas, with offices and projects in the United States and Canada. Webber supports a wide range of project models to meet client needs, including traditional design bid build, design build, alternative delivery models and public private partnership (P3) solutions. Webber also has an in-house engineering services department to help optimize building efficiency and quality while solving complex project challenges using field experience, innovative construction methods and BIM technology. As a subsidiary of Ferrovial, Webber has access to a global network of skilled engineers, best-in-class technology and vast resources.

Job Description : Regular Job Duties

Collaborate with foremen and superintendents to ensure that work plans are tracked and analyzed to maximize efficiency in the field operations.

Develop, maintain, and report the daily quantities installed and performed

Analyze and compare budgeted vs actual production rates and yield in materials

Perform quantity take-offs from plans and contrast weekly field quantities and plan quantities

Assist in the development of Work Activity Plans

Provide monthly quantity reports for verification of owner quantities and monthly billing

Assist in ensuring that field work is being constructed within project standards and specifications

Provide support for project engineers and superintendents as required

Maintain and organize Plan Drawings, Revisions, and As-Builts

Assist in maintaining all Project Logs

Assess, compare, and monitor quantities ordered with materials budgeted

Maintain the Notevault Diary and provide schedule updates to the Project Engineer

Initiate, drive, and control Field Operations Reports

Develop Look Ahead Schedules with the project superintendent

Present information effectively in one-on-one and small group situations including managers and employees

Read and interpret documents such as safety rules, Operating and Maintenance Instructions, Procedure Manuals, Contracts, Subcontracts, and Purchase Orders

Qualifications

Bachelor's Degree in Civil Engineering, Construction Management, or something similar

Moderate to high level of proficiency operating Primavera 3 and 6

Moderate to high level of proficiency operating MS Excel, MS Outlook, MS Word, and MS PowerPoint

Be able to communicate in English via verbal and written communications

A demonstrated ability to multi task, be a self-starter, and have a passion for construction and a job well done

Ability to apply concepts of basic algebra and geometry and utilize Construction Math concepts

Valid driver license for occasional, required travel

Ability to define problems, collect data, establish facts, and draw valid conclusions

Ability to interpret an extensive variety of technical instructions in mathematical or diagram form and deal with abstract and concrete variables

Moderate physical activity performing somewhat strenuous daily activities of a primarily administrative nature.

Some exposure to outdoors with changing weather conditions such as rain, sun, snow, and wind

Ability to physically maneuver by foot minor obstacles at construction projects

Manual dexterity sufficient to reach / handle items and work with the fingers
